Inpatient Treatment - Drug and Alcohol Treatment Centers - West Peoria, IL.

Inpatient drug rehab, also sometimes called residential drug rehab, is a rehab method for people that want a change of environment and receive very comprehensive treatment. Inpatient rehab in West Peoria usually lasts anywhere from 30 days to 3 - 6 months or longer, and many facilities offer both short and long term rehabilitation options. Some inpatient programs are prepared to provide both drug free and medically assisted detox services, but some only accept clients who have already been detoxed at a detox facility prior to arrival.

In inpatient drug rehab, it is much like a small community of clients and staff who are working collectively through the course of rehabilitation. Professional staff will do a complete assessment of the client's treatment needs, and a rehabilitation strategy is developed that may involve therapy, counseling, psychotherapy, holistic treatment, etc. all depending on what rehabilitation approach the rehab center is practicing. Some inpatient programs focus on the 12 steps, whereas others utilize a therapeutic behavioral method, which could involve more advanced therapies and psychotherapies.

Inpatient drug rehab also minimizes many of the risks associated with relapse, because the individual is under constant supervision in a drug and alcohol free atmosphere, and won't be tempted by any of the drug using friends who motivated, encouraged or enabled their drug abuse.
